Harley-Davidson Announces Fourth Quarter, Full-Year 2018 Results
January 29, 2019 6:50 AM ESTMILWAUKEE, Jan. 29, 2019 /PRNewswire/ -- Harley-Davidson, Inc. (NYSE: HOG) today reported fourth quarter and full-year 2018 results. On a full-year basis, earnings per share (EPS) was up year-over-year on positive revenue growth. The company achieved all stated 2018 milestones associated with its More Roads to Harley-Davidson accelerated plan for growth.
Full-Year 2018
More Roads accelerated plan for growth unveiled; all 2018 milestones achieved Diluted EPS up 5.6 percent over prior year Record Financial Services segment operating income Cash from operations up over $200 million or 20 percent compared to 2017... More
